'He Truly Saved the World:' Iranian Refugee Calls for Trump to Receive Nobel Peace Prize

AP Photo/Jose Luis Magana

An Iranian refugee who has spoken out against the brutal regime in Tehran is praising President Donald Trump for what she calls a historic act of courage that "truly saved the world" after he dismantled Iran’s nuclear program in a surprise attack on Saturday. While progressive politicians and media elites call for the impeachment of Trump over the legality of the strike, those who’ve actually lived under the tyranny of Iran know that Trump’s bold action was a game-changer.

Ellie Cohanim, former Deputy Special Envoy to Combat Antisemitism during the first Trump administration, said President Trump deserves the Nobel Peace Prize for giving the world “peace through strength.” 

“President Trump has truly saved the world, and I certainly hope that we will see recognition for what he has accomplished for the entire world. He deserves a Nobel Peace Prize for this," she said. 

Cohanim also praised Trump’s decisive move to dismantle Iran’s nuclear capabilities, calling it “a new hope” for the Middle East. She expressed optimism that this bold action could pave the way for lasting peace between Israel and its neighbors.

She’s not alone in saying President Trump deserves the Nobel Peace Prize for his actions—leaders and commentators from Pakistan and several others have echoed that sentiment, applauding his bold stand against Iran’s nuclear threat.

Pakistan officially nominated President Trump for the Nobel Peace Prize, crediting him with a “decisive diplomatic intervention” during a volatile period of regional conflict. Earlier this year, the Pakistani government applauded Trump’s “pivotal leadership” in helping de-escalate tensions following a series of deadly cross-border attacks—the worst clashes between the two nuclear-armed neighbors since 1971. The violence had claimed dozens of lives and raised serious concerns about a potential broader war.

Others, including Fox News’ Sean Hannity, have also supported awarding President Trump the Nobel Peace Prize. In a conversation with Townhall’s Katie Pavlich, Hannity praised Trump’s bold leadership and the global impact of his actions.
